Did you know only 2 in every 10 Americans feel prepared for a major disaster, yet 82% said they would take the steps to get prepared if only they knew how? The American Red Cross is here to help.
The St. Louis Area Chapter offers free disaster education programs for people of all ages. Each year, tens of thousands of St. Louis area residents take part in these presentations at schools, businesses and community events.
It is the Red Cross' mission to help the community prevent, prepare for and respond to disasters. A disaster can strike at any moment, the Red Cross wants to show you and your family how to be ready.
